Establishing in vitro Protein Digestibility as an Alternative to Animal Testing

Recorded June 17, 2021

Continuing Education Hours: IAFNS is a Continuing Professional Education (CPE) provider with the Commission on Dietetic Registration (CDR). CDR Credentialed Practitioners will receive 1.0 Continuing Professional Education Unit (CPEU) for completion of this recorded webinar until June 17, 2024.

Description: As an alternative to animal testing, this session provides the rationale and approach for an inter-laboratory study protocol for the purpose of gaining an official method of analysis status for determining protein digestibility using in-vitro approaches. The primary aim is to gain feedback on this approach from differing stakeholders involved in calculating protein quality for foods and food ingredients.
